Home
last modified time | relevance | path

Searched refs:HLSLToolChain (Results 1 – 3 of 3) sorted by relevance

/freebsd/contrib/llvm-project/clang/lib/Driver/ToolChains/
H A DHLSL.cpp251 HLSLToolChain::HLSLToolChain(const Driver &D, const llvm::Triple &Triple, in HLSLToolChain() function in HLSLToolChain
259 Tool *clang::driver::toolchains::HLSLToolChain::getTool( in getTool()
276 clang::driver::toolchains::HLSLToolChain::parseTargetProfile( in parseTargetProfile()
282 HLSLToolChain::TranslateArgs(const DerivedArgList &Args, StringRef BoundArch, in TranslateArgs()
388 bool HLSLToolChain::requiresValidation(DerivedArgList &Args) const { in requiresValidation()
403 bool HLSLToolChain::requiresBinaryTranslation(DerivedArgList &Args) const { in requiresBinaryTranslation()
407 bool HLSLToolChain::isLastJob(DerivedArgList &Args, in isLastJob()
H A DHLSL.h50 class LLVM_LIBRARY_VISIBILITY HLSLToolChain : public ToolChain {
52 HLSLToolChain(const Driver &D, const llvm::Triple &Triple,
/freebsd/contrib/llvm-project/clang/lib/Driver/
H A DDriver.cpp1597 toolchains::HLSLToolChain::parseTargetProfile(TargetProfile)) in BuildCompilation()
4692 static_cast<const toolchains::HLSLToolChain &>(C.getDefaultToolChain()); in BuildActions()
6277 const auto &TC = static_cast<const toolchains::HLSLToolChain &>( in GetNamedOutputPath()
6929 TC = std::make_unique<toolchains::HLSLToolChain>(*this, Target, Args); in getToolChain()